Just saw "Space Pilot 3000" for the first time since 1999, and after all this time watching the show I was struck by how much the characters - especially vocally - have evolved.

But also I noticed something I wanted to discuss and figured here's as good a place as any....

I think it's during this episode that we see Bender's first display of truly criminal behavior - when he stole Leela's ring.  And I think it's because he met Fry that he developed this aberration in his programming.

It could be argued that there are two earlier examples: when he yanked back his quarter in the suicide booth and when he ran from the cops.  But
I think the quarter ploy just shows that he's a cheap robot.  As for running from the cops - who wouldn't?  The only other option was to stay and be dragooned back into a job you hated.  (After the cops went 24 Century on ya, that is!)

Here's my theory - Bender "downloaded" his criminal behavior while in the Room of Criminal Heads.  Somehow, when his antenna made contact with the exposed wiring of the overhead light, he integrated the mental engrams of one or more of the criminal heads nearby.

As for Bender and criminal activity, don't forget that the "see the world through the eyes of a bending unit" goggles in "Mother's Day" imply that ALL bending units are criminals.  And didn't Matt Groening say something about all robots on the show setting bad examples?  I believe I've said this before, but, for what it's worth, I don't think the shock from the lightbulb started Bender's criminal behavior, since that was most likely part of his programming in the first place (why, I really wouldn't know).  It did, however, allow him to go against his programming in becoming something other than a girder-bender.
